As Taiwan's foreign exchange reserves soared to become the second biggest in the world after Japan's by 1987,5 pressures mounted to liberalize stringent foreign exchange controls that had been in place for almost four decades. Removal of most of the exchange controls in 1987 was a milestone in Taiwan's development. It signalled, long after the event, that Taiwan has moved so far from the normal condition of underdevelopment that it can generate sufficient export earnings to cover all expected demands for foreign exchange.

Market guidance was effected by augmenting the supply of investible resources, spreading or "socializing" the risks attached to long-term investment, and steering the allocation of investment by methods which combine government and entrepreneurial preferences. In particular, the governments guided the market by: (I) redistributing agricultural land in the early postwar period; (2) controlling the financial system and making private financial capital subordinate to industrial capital; (3) maintaining stability in some of the main economic parameters that affect the viability of long-term investment, especially the exchange rate, the interest rate, and the general price level; (4) modulating the impact of foreign competition in the domestic economy and prioritizing the use of scarce foreign exchange; (5) promoting exports; (6) promoting technology acquisition from multinational companies and building a national technology system; and (7) assisting 28 CHAPTER I particular industries.

The question of whether measures designed by a well-meaning bureaucracy can achieve results superior to those which a more liberal market system would produce is impossible to answer conclusively; what would have happened in the absence of the intervention is always unknown. Nonetheless, economists from Adam Smith onwards have not hesitated to make strong assertions, both positive and negative, about the effectiveness of government intervention without offering serious evidence to support their claims.
